Houston process servers play a critical role in the legal system by ensuring that legal documents are delivered accurately, lawfully, and on time. These professionals are responsible for serving court papers such as subpoenas, summonses, complaints, writs, and other legal notices to individuals or businesses involved in legal proceedings. In a large and diverse city like Houston, process servers must navigate complex neighborhoods, busy schedules, and strict legal requirements. Their work helps guarantee due process, ensuring that all parties are properly notified and given the opportunity to respond in court. Without dependable process servers, legal cases could face delays, dismissals, or procedural complications that affect justice.
